Originally Posted by Cels: View Post
do we know what the scope of the public beta will cover?
So far all we know is that it will cover only the Charr, Human and Norn races and will include Lion's Arch (which wasn't in previous tests). WvW and Competitive PVP are in. I would be surprised if we can level much higher than level 30 or so, however. Previous tests let you kick your character up to 30 to try the Ascalon Catacombs, but this was likely just for the Press.
